Output e31fc7f24f130b175eed0c7323ab9a90ba7451bc110786cacf47c0b61b410392:0

value
3735772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74f9add0d46e9ee27d879dd9bb8ac01badf89391 OP_EQUAL
address
3CMXQo4GcH4x1MPiwAKGaK1vNuNadsobwK
transaction
e31fc7f24f130b175eed0c7323ab9a90ba7451bc110786cacf47c0b61b410392
confirmations
124404
spent
true